diff --git a/src/mtgcoll/core.clj b/src/mtgcoll/core.clj index b0b7c04..20c0123 100644 --- a/src/mtgcoll/core.clj +++ b/src/mtgcoll/core.clj @@ -15,7 +15,7 @@ [mtgcoll.db :as db] [mtgcoll.models.mtgjson :refer [load-mtgjson-data!]] [mtgcoll.scrapers.image-assets :refer [download-gatherer-set-images! download-gatherer-symbol-images!]] - [mtgcoll.scrapers.common :refer [update-prices!]] + [mtgcoll.scrapers.prices :refer [update-prices!]] [mtgcoll.views.core :as views] [mtgcoll.views.sente :as sente] [mtgcoll.routes.main-page :refer [main-page-routes]] diff --git a/src/mtgcoll/scrapers/list.clj b/src/mtgcoll/scrapers/list.clj deleted file mode 100644 index 01fa0d2..0000000 --- a/src/mtgcoll/scrapers/list.clj +++ /dev/null @@ -1,9 +0,0 @@ -(ns mtgcoll.scrapers.list - (:require - mtgcoll.scrapers.mtggoldfish) - (:import - (mtgcoll.scrapers.mtggoldfish MTGGoldFishPriceScraper))) - -(def price-scrapers - {:mtggoldfish (MTGGoldFishPriceScraper.)}) - diff --git a/src/mtgcoll/scrapers/common.clj b/src/mtgcoll/scrapers/prices.clj similarity index 92% rename from src/mtgcoll/scrapers/common.clj rename to src/mtgcoll/scrapers/prices.clj index 105848e..96c24dc 100644 --- a/src/mtgcoll/scrapers/common.clj +++ b/src/mtgcoll/scrapers/prices.clj @@ -1,4 +1,4 @@ -(ns mtgcoll.scrapers.common +(ns mtgcoll.scrapers.prices (:require [views.core :as views] [views.sql.core :refer [hint-type]] @@ -6,7 +6,7 @@ [mtgcoll.models.cards :as cards] [mtgcoll.models.sets :as sets] [mtgcoll.scrapers.protocols :refer [scrape]] - [mtgcoll.scrapers.list :refer [price-scrapers]] + [mtgcoll.scrapers.registered :refer [price-scrapers]] [mtgcoll.db :as db])) (defn update-prices! diff --git a/src/mtgcoll/scrapers/mtggoldfish.clj b/src/mtgcoll/scrapers/prices/mtggoldfish.clj similarity index 98% rename from src/mtgcoll/scrapers/mtggoldfish.clj rename to src/mtgcoll/scrapers/prices/mtggoldfish.clj index 51117ec..65a3dc6 100644 --- a/src/mtgcoll/scrapers/mtggoldfish.clj +++ b/src/mtgcoll/scrapers/prices/mtggoldfish.clj @@ -1,4 +1,4 @@ -(ns mtgcoll.scrapers.mtggoldfish +(ns mtgcoll.scrapers.prices.mtggoldfish (:require [clojure.string :as string] [clj-http.client :as http] diff --git a/src/mtgcoll/scrapers/registered.clj b/src/mtgcoll/scrapers/registered.clj new file mode 100644 index 0000000..66bb73c --- /dev/null +++ b/src/mtgcoll/scrapers/registered.clj @@ -0,0 +1,9 @@ +(ns mtgcoll.scrapers.registered + (:require + mtgcoll.scrapers.prices.mtggoldfish) + (:import + (mtgcoll.scrapers.prices.mtggoldfish MTGGoldFishPriceScraper))) + +(def price-scrapers + {:mtggoldfish (MTGGoldFishPriceScraper.)}) +